Transaction 05496c705321d9aa9abdb475cbae91678e92b1b0582a9ca40d89252a8d1c943a

1 Input
2 Outputs
  • 05496c705321d9aa9abdb475cbae91678e92b1b0582a9ca40d89252a8d1c943a:0
  • value  1876543
    address  34cQZxa5BkTNV21XXWMCcTuCnzhUj1fGoN
  • 05496c705321d9aa9abdb475cbae91678e92b1b0582a9ca40d89252a8d1c943a:1
  • value  27088855
    address  1BA5acjo2WADA8Xuj8J6iMpjzPDvtzo2EF